Jawa Reveals New Limited-Run 42 Tawang Edition

- Special Edition Jawa 42 limited to just 100 units
- Available only in Arunachal Pradesh and neighbouring regions
- Gets a custom livery inspired by local folk legends
Jawa Motorcycles has revealed a limited-run Tawang Edition of the Jawa 42 at the Torgya Festival in Tawang, Arunachal Pradesh. Limited to just 100 units the motorcycle will be available in Arunachal Pradesh and neighbouring regions.
The Tawang Edition is based around the 42 Sports Stripe Allstar Black featuring unique motifs on the body panels. The motifs for the special edition are based around Lungta, a mythical wind horse which forms part of the region’s legends and symbolises prosperity and good fortune. The motifs feature on the fuel tank and fenders and are accompanied by inscriptions inspired by the region. Every motorcycle also gets a unique numbered bronze medallion to mark the special edition units.
Mechanically, the special edition 42 is identical to the standard model featuring an 294.72cc single cylinder engine developing 27 bhp and 26.84 Nm.
